rest_delete_widget

动作钩子
do_action( 'rest_delete_widget', $widget_id, $sidebar_id, $response, $request )
参数
  • (string) $widget_id ID of the widget marked for deletion.
    Required:
  • (string) $sidebar_id ID of the sidebar the widget was deleted from.
    Required:
  • (WP_REST_Response|WP_Error) $response The response data, or WP_Error object on failure.
    Required:
  • (WP_REST_Request) $request The request sent to the API.
    Required:
定义位置
相关勾子
delete_widgetrest_prepare_widgetrest_delete_commentrest_delete_userrest_after_save_widget
相关方法
register_widgetretrieve_widgetsunregister_widgetregister_sidebar_widgetis_active_widgetwp_render_widget
引入
5.8.0
弃用
-

rest_delete_widget: 当一个widget通过REST API被删除时,这个动作会被触发。它允许开发者在小工具被删除时执行额外的动作,如删除相关数据或触发通知。

在一个小工具通过REST API被删除后触发。

do_action( 'rest_delete_widget', $widget_id, $sidebar_id, $response, $request );

常见问题

FAQs
查看更多 >